Researchers develop better microbial conversion pathway for xylose

December 30, 2014 |

In New York state, a researcher from Hofstra University has led a team that discovered a microbial conversion pathway using Clostridium clariflavum to better degrade xylan to xylooligomers and xylose which also appears to allow higher utilization of unused biomass. The research used switchgrass as feedstock.
